The Division of Infectious Disease at the Mayo Clinic in Rochester, MN, is seeking two board certified/board eligible academic infectious disease physicians. The Division of Infectious Diseases is comprised of more than 30 physicians providing expertise in over 10 different focus areas of infectious diseases. Mayo Clinic is a renowned tertiary care center involved in the management of infectious diseases in patients referred from locations around the nation and worldwide. The division supports an ACGME-accredited fellowship in general infectious diseases and two non-accredited advanced fellowships in Orthopedic and Transplant Infectious Diseases. Responsibilities of the consultant positions include participation in inpatient consultative services, outpatient infectious diseases clinics, telemedicine consultations, patient care quality and safety initiatives, and career development activities in education and/or research. The Infectious Diseases Division is open to considering alternate FTE opportunities. Qualifications Additional qualifications License or certification Qualifications: Candidates should have Infectious Diseases fellowship training and be ABIM Board Certified/Board Eligible in Infectious Diseases. Evidence of academic productivity with a commitment to research and/or education in Infectious Diseases is expected. Interest in outpatient ID, telemedicine, quality and outcomes, and subspecialty inpatient consultations is preferred. These positions will include an academic appointment with the Mayo Clinic College of Medicine and Science.
